域名备案系统作为互联网管理的重要环节,是确保网站合法运营的关键基础设施,其源码的规范性与安全性直接影响备案效率和数据合规性,本文将深入探讨域名备案系统源码的核心设计逻辑、技术要点及开发实践。
域名备案系统的核心功能模块
1、用户身份核验:通过OCR识别、活体检测等技术实现企业/个人实名认证,源码需集成公安部门接口进行数据比对。
2、域名与主体关联:采用数据库关联模型(如MySQL)存储域名、主办单位、服务器IP的映射关系,需支持多级审核流程。
3、自动化审核引擎:基于规则引擎(如Drools)实现智能初审,减少人工干预,源码需包含黑白名单过滤、敏感词检测等算法。
源码开发的技术挑战
安全性要求:需遵循等保2.0标准,采用SHA-256加密传输数据,防止中间人攻击。
高并发处理:通过Redis缓存备案状态,结合消息队列(如RabbitMQ)异步处理峰值请求。
多平台兼容性:系统需适配各省通信管理局的API差异,设计可插拔的接口适配层。
开源实践与合规建议
目前国内备案系统多为闭源项目,但开发者可参考GitHub上的模拟项目(如icp-license-system)学习基础架构,需注意:
1、避免直接使用未授权的第三方代码,防止知识产权风险。
2、备案数据必须存储于境内服务器,源码中需硬编码地理围栏检测逻辑。
域名备案系统源码的优化是提升政务数字化效率的重要途径,随着区块链技术的引入,去中心化备案或将成为可能,但核心仍在于平衡监管需求与技术开放性。(字数:426)
注:实际开发需严格遵循《非经营性互联网信息服务备案管理办法》,建议与持证IDC服务商合作。
域名备案其实并不复杂,只是关联到很多知识,有些客户没有接触过,就不知道从哪里入手,课晏云从事备案服务十多年,有丰富的经验,不仅可以顺利、快速的完成备案,还可以提供网络各方面的专业咨询,加微信:16510012662 让你省时省心省钱!